How to Use This IFSC Code

NEFT Transfer

Use IFSC code SBIN0000918 to send money via NEFT to this branch. NEFT transfers are processed in hourly batches during working hours. No minimum amount required.

RTGS Transfer

This branch supports RTGS for high-value instant transfers above ₹2 lakhs. Use the same IFSC code SBIN0000918.

IMPS Transfer

IMPS is available 24×7 including holidays. Maximum ₹5 lakhs per transaction. Use IFSC code SBIN0000918.

  • SBIN — Bank code (State Bank of India)
  • 0 — Reserved (always 0)
  • 000918 — Branch code (SIVAGANGA)
